sl55 or cl55?

Hey guys,
newbe here. Looking to purchase a 03-05 sl55 or cl55. My concern with the sl is with the top. Does it begin to rattle/squeek over time or is it truly like a hard top when up? Also is one more reliable than the other? I've also been told to make sure it has a warranty. Both are awesome cars and making a decision between the two is not easy. Any input would be great thanks.

Originally Posted by nvno1
...Does it begin to rattle/squeek over time or is it truly like a hard top when up?
The retractable top on my 2003 SL is dead quiet most of the time. I sometimes experience a creaking noise after I've parked outside in hot, sunny weather for a few hours. The noise goes away after the car cools off. I presume the cause is metal expanding and contracting.

I have both the CL55 and SL55. Of the 2 the the SL has been more reliable. The CL has had a number of elctronic problems, instrument cluster being the biggest culprit. Even though the CL has a back seat it is for small adults or children to be used on short trips. The SL in this case is the winner
